For example, would allowing > 2 GPIOs be acceptable, or should this case be handled in a different way? > In line with Daniel’s suggestion, I am planning to adopt a fixed upper limit for the number of backlight GPIOs. The current hardware only requires two GPIOs, so the maxItems can be set to 2. If future platforms or customers require support for a higher number of GPIOs, this limit can be increased and the driver can be updated accordingly.
